Default Batter Drain on my 2014 IS 350 F SPORT

I purchased my brand new 2014 IS 350 F Sport back in November 2013.I have experienced this battery drain 4 times ever since
Every time this has happened i have used the car the previous night and left it in my car port only to come back the following morning and realize my car wouldn't start.
I have had the same issues as others members have expressed with the rapid clicking noise and after the jump start the car works fine for a few months only to realize it happens again.
The third time this happened i had Lexus replace my old battery with a brand new interstate battery which obviously didn't resolve the issue
I have had the car for a little over a year now with 11500 miles on it and the car is currently at the dealership and they are inspecting it
The Service manager called me this afternoon advising that Lexus feels its an issue with the ECU and that replacing it would fix it.He said he will get the ECU on monday
Would be interesting to know if this resolves the issue i shall keep you all posted

Default '14 IS350 battery replaced twice

Just finding this thread so I'm glad to see I'm not the only one having this problem. My car died, sitting in the garage at 1900 miles. Lexus roadside assistance came out and replaced the battery. I'm of the opinion that a dead battery that is six months old needs to be replaced, not jumped. The guy that came out said we would be good friends as long as I own this car, he keeps spares in his vehicle for these cars. The new battery died at 2900 miles, again they came out and replaced it. Both times he said it was probably a bad cell. I'm taking it in this week to get checked out. I knkw I don't put a lot of miles on the car, 2900 in the first year, but my '11 IS250 got the same treatment and never had a problem. He did suggest always locking the doors, even in the garage, as this would alert me if there are any doors or anything open. Very strange!
